    A recent find North of Hanover, I think its right as I didn't pay much and it was with a right as rain Luftschutz scuttle helmet.
    I believe it is Fire service in the transition to Third Reich, probably 1935/6? I'm sure someone out there will have the exact spec.
    Looks like it had a comb at some point and it has been removed and the holes filled.
    It is marked with a sitting lion over DRP and the word Thale with a large N to the right.

    Default Re: Fire Sevice ???

    Hi Jock, you are correct. These decals were introduced on July 10th 1934.

    It is a good original helmet.
